7 more than double a number is equal to five less than triple that number. What is that number?

Respuesta :

mxtb mxtb
  • 04-05-2020
Answer:

12

Explanation:

You can solve this problem by setting up an equation.

7 more that double a number is just 2x + 7
Five less than triple that number is just 3x - 5

Since they are equal to each other, you can set them equally to each other.

2x + 7 = 3x - 5

Solve.

7 + 5 = 3x - 2x

x = 12
